DCCAllow is a command that you would use if someone wants to send you a file but you are having trouble receiving you would type

DCCAllow +<Nickname>

and on most occasions this would put them in a category that allows them to send you files....I had this problem when someone wanted to send me a pic. After I had typed in the dccallow command it came through. Im hoping thats what you wanted to hear

This command works on Chatnet anyways...thats where i used to chat

If the network requires it on certain file types, you would see a notice prolly in your status window telling you so. Be sure you use /dccallow +nicknamehere (with the / and no space between the + and the nickname).

If the prob is that you have mIRC set to block a certain file type, you would also see a msg to that effect in which case you would need to add that file type to those not ignored in your dcc options.
